Web18 mrt. 2024 · How ETFs work ETF structure. ETFs are structured like mutual funds but traded on an exchange like individual stocks. ETFs are created when a financial institution purchases a basket of underlying assets that track a specific index or sector. The institution then issues shares that represent ownership in the underlying assets. WebThe ETF is basically worth the sum of its assets. The assets inside it are stocks and cash.If the stocks go up, the ETF price goes up. If the Fund distributes dividends, the cash portion goes down, and so does the ETF price. If it accumulates them, the cash portion goes down, but the stocks portion goes up as it uses the cash to buy more stocks.
